Just wanted to share another short video on where I'm at with the college update.

Here's a rundown of what's been added:

  • Team Colors - Definitely want to add more color to the game and am stating by including the team colors everywhere team text shows up.

  • Updated Meet Scoring - In first pass, meet scoring was just random number generator, it has now been dialed in so it responds to the meet simulation and is aligned with how T&F really works.

  • Team/Coach Effects - This is in its infancy, but in dual meets your coach now provides you a gentle instruction (take it easy this week; we need this win; etc.) and you'll get a small mentality bonus or penalty for both the meet result and following instructions. Whenever I add a feature like this, I make the bonus a bit trivial to start. More to come.

  • Last But Not Least - Balancing - After some helpful playtesting from the community and many automated sim runs from me, I think we nailed the game balance so that high school to college freshman and college freshman to senior year feel natural in terms of performance gains and competition.
